Setup: enable the Tracelink sidecar, set the collector endpoint to staging, and confirm span export with `tracelink verify`. Propagation headers are injected automatically once auth succeeds. Per-service tokens are rotated monthly; do not reuse across environments. For local verification against the staging collector, authenticate with the key below.

gateway credential: kto3_qfe

// DATE FORMAT LOCALES — Brindlework app
//
// This constant maps region codes to date patterns for the
// Brindlework booking screens. Do not hardcode formats in views;
// always go through this table. Marta's locale audit found three
// screens bypassing it — fixed in the Q2 sweep. Adding a region?
// Update the snapshot tests too, or CI fails on the Tethervale
// runner. Validation runs per build; the build token for the last
// verified pass is recorded directly below.

pipeline stamp: htk21_86b657ac0aa916a9af17f

Ticket: Fablecrate factories leak state between plugin tests

Hey folks — if your plugin uses Fablecrate's `sequence()` helper, heads up: sequences aren't reset between suites, so IDs drift and snapshot tests get flaky. We've got a fix that scopes sequences per test run. Pin to the patched release once it's out and regenerate snapshots. The prerelease build we'd like plugin authors to try is tagged below.

pipeline stamp: htk31_f769b577b3028a4e9958e5bb8d1259a

CI note — GiveLetter receipt mailer. Nightly build red since Tuesday. Template renderer fails on currencies with no minor units; snapshot tests drift. Fix landed on branch mailer-hotfix, pinned the locale lib, regenerated snapshots. Quarantined the flaky SMTP stub test pending rewrite. Pipeline green as of this morning. The failing run's token is pasted below for reference.

trace token, fafog-kageg: htk4_98e6

Facilities ticket — Halewick Tower, night shift.

Issue: support team reporting east stairwell reader rejecting badges after midnight. Reader was reset this morning; firmware updated. Overnight crew should now badge as normal. If the reader fails again, use the manual keypad by the fire door — do not prop the door. Log any further failures with the time and badge name. Temporary keypad code for the fallback door is below.

door code, tajeg-fawip: bdg-K-62